What is the cheapest day to fly to Louisiana?

The average price of all flights from the U.S. Virgin Islands to Louisiana cl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Louisiana is Sunday where round-trip tickets can be as cheap as $324.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Saturday, where round-trip prices are $848 on average.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Louisiana?

The average price for all round-trip flights from the U.S. Virgin Islands to Louisiana depending on the time of departure, clicked by users on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.
The cheapest time of day to fly to Louisiana is generally in the morning, when round-trip flights cost $360 on average. Morning departures are around 30%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Louisiana is generally in the afternoon,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$572.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from the U.S. Virgin Islands to Louisiana?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from the U.S. Virgin Islands to Louisiana with an airline and back with another airline.
